A brief incomplete introduction to nltk this introduction ignores and simpli. These archives contain all the content in the documentation. Nltk is one of the leading platforms for working with human language data and python, the module nltk is used for natural language processing. Beautiful soup documentation beautiful soup is a python library for pulling data out of html and xml files. When using the online python documentation, be aware that your. Python 3 text processing with nltk 3 cookbook over 80 practical recipes on natural language processing techniques using python s nltk 3.
Break text down into its component parts for spelling correction, feature extraction, and phrase transformation. Incorporating a significant amount of example code from this book into your products documentation does require permission. Nltk documentation pdf loper, has been published by oreilly media inc. Netis a package which provides near seamless integration of a natively installed python installation with the. Click download or read online button to get nltk explanation python in pdf book now. With these scripts, you can do the following things without writing a single line of code. The nicaragua u s a judgement pdf nltk book is currently being updated for python 3 and nltk nitro pdf comparison 3. In addition to software and documentation, nltk provides substantial corpus samples. This is the inverse approach to that taken by ironpython see above, to which it is more complementary than competing with. We strongly encourage you to download python and nltk, and try out the examples and exercises along the way. Many other libraries give access to file formats such as pdf, msword, and xml pypdf, pywin32. Please post any questions about the materials to the nltk users mailing list. I hope you are looking a book for some advance modules like nltk, scikit learn, requests, etc, because for basic and inbuilt modules in python 2 and python 3 as well, some good books are already mentioned in previo. Ironpython in action by michael foord and christian muirhead, offers a comprehensive, handson introduction to ironpython for programming the.
Download nltk explanation python in pdf or read nltk explanation python in pdf online books in pdf, epub and mobi format. An effective way for students to learn is simply to work through the materials, with the help of other students and. Gensim is a free python framework designed to automatically extract semantic topics from documents, as ef. Numpy 8 standard python distribution doesnt come bundled with numpy module. In this article you will learn how to tokenize data by words and sentences. This book is a collection of materials that ive used when conducting python training and also materials from my web site that are intended for selfinstruction. Languagelog,, dr dobbs this book is made available under the terms of the creative commons attribution noncommercial noderivativeworks 3. It provides a simple api for diving into common natural language processing nlp tasks such as partofspeech tagging, noun phrase extraction, sentiment analysis, classification, translation, and more.
The natural language toolkit is a suite of program modules, data sets and tutorials supporting research and teaching in computational linguistics and natural language processing. Changelogtextblob is a python 2 and 3 library for processing textual data. Learn how to do custom sentiment analysis and named entity recognition. This version of the nltk book is updated for python 3 and nltk. It is the companion book to an impressive opensource software library called the natural language toolkit nltk, written in python. Use features like bookmarks, note taking and highlighting while reading python 3 text processing with nltk 3 cookbook. Here is the wumpus grammar from the book figure 22. This toolkit is one of the most powerful nlp libraries which contains packages to make machines understand human language and reply to it with an appropriate response. Japanese translation of nltk book november 2010 masato hagiwara has translated the nltk book into japanese, along with an extra chapter on particular issues with japanese language. It provides easytouse interfaces to over 50 corpora and lexical resources such as wordnet, along with a suite of text processing libraries for classification, tokenization, stemming, tagging, parsing, and semantic reasoning, wrappers for industrialstrength nlp libraries.
Nltk contains code supporting dozens of nlp tasks, along with 30. Python and the natural language toolkit sourceforge. Syntactic parsing is a technique by which segmented, tokenized, and partofspeech tagged text is assigned a structure that reveals the relationships between tokens governed by syntax rules, e. Some advanced usages such as class and exceptions are not needed in order to get familiar with nltk. Teaching and learning python and nltk this book contains selfpaced learning materials including many examples and exercises. Jun 22, 2018 syntax parsing with corenlp and nltk 22 jun 2018. An attribution usually includes the title, author, publisher, and isbn. Natural language processing with python nltk is one of the leading platforms for working with human language data and python, the module nltk is used for natural language processing. While reading the book, you should sit on the terminal and type the examples from the book. Natural language processing with python steven bird. Preface audience, emphasis, what you will learn, organization, why python. Nltk trainer is a set of python command line scripts for natural language processing. Natural language processingand this book is your answer. Pdf the natural language toolkit is a suite of program modules, data sets and tutorials supporting research and teaching in com putational.
Distributions are provided for windows, macintosh and unix platforms. A lightweight alternative is to install numpy using popular python package installer, pip. It provides easytouse interfaces to over 50 corpora and lexical. Learn more about how to make python better for everyone. Pushpak bhattacharyya center for indian language technology department of computer science and engineering indian institute of technology bombay.
Nltk is literally an acronym for natural language toolkit. Natural language processing using python with nltk, scikitlearn and stanford nlp apis viva institute of technology, 2016 instructor. You may prefer a machine readable copy of this book. Book natural language processing with python analyzing text with the natural language toolkit steven bird, ewan klein, and edward loper notetaking in graduate school justin dunnavant is a phd student in anthropology at the university of florida. Nltk is written in python and distributed under the gpl open source license.
This book comes with batteries included a reference to the phrase often used to explain the popularity of the python programming language. Download it once and read it on your kindle device, pc, phones or tablets. This is the raw content of the book, including many details we are not interested in such as whitespace, line breaks and blank lines. It provides easytouse interfaces to over 50 corpora and lexical resources such as wordnet, along with a suite of text processing libraries for classification, tokenization, stemming, tagging, parsing, and semantic reasoning, wrappers for industrialstrength nlp libraries, and. Are these collections the same as the object book in python. He is the author of python text processing with nltk 2. Open source software is made better when users can easily contribute code and documentation to fix bugs and add features. Note if the content not found, you must refresh this page manually. December 2010 jacob perkins has written a 250page cookbook full of great recipes for text processing using python and nltk, published by packt publishing. The natural language toolkit nltk is a python package for natural language processing. Nltk book python 3 edition university of pittsburgh.
Over 80 practical recipes on natural language processing techniques using python s nltk 3. Install on your own machine but make sure your code for assignments runs on cdf. The online version of the book has been been updated for python 3 and nltk 3. Some of the royalties are being donated to the nltk project. Student, new rkoy university natural language processing in python with tknl. Python 3 text processing with nltk 3 cookbook, perkins, jacob. Python strongly encourages community involvement in improving the software. The book is based on the python programming language together with an open source. Sep 27, 2016 nltk essentials build cool nlp and machine learning applications using nltk and other python libraries by nitin hardeniya. Which is the best reference book about python modules. Please post any questions about the materials to the nltkusers mailing list.
Natural language processing with python data science association. Nltkthe natural language toolkitis a suite of open source python modules, data and documentation for research and development in natural language processing. As graduate students, we are confronted with the daunting task of. Nltk is a leading platform for building python programs to work with human. The natural language toolkit nltk is an open source python library for natural language processing. Youre right that its quite hard to find the documentation for the book. If you use the library for academic research, please cite the book. Nltk tutorial pdf nltk tutorial pdf nltk tutorial pdf download. It works with your favorite parser to provide idiomatic ways of navigating, searching, and modifying the parse tree.
Basic concepts about python programming language is required. It provides easytouse interfaces to over 50 corpora and lexical resources such as wordnet, along with a suite of text processing libraries for classification, tokenization, stemming, tagging, parsing, and semantic reasoning, wrappers for industrialstrength nlp libraries, and an active discussion forum. Pdf natural language processing using python researchgate. Sooner or later you will have to consult the excellent official python documentation.
Nltk is a leading platform for building python programs to work with human language data. I would like to thank the author of the book, who has made a good job for both python and nltk. It will demystify the advanced features of text analysis and text mining using the comprehensive nltk. Nltk tutorial pdf the nltk website contains excellent documentation and tutorials for learn. Extracting text from pdf, msword, and other binary formats. The variable raw contains a string with 1,176,893 characters.
Tokenization, stemming, lemmatization, punctuation, character count, word count are some of these packages which will be discussed in. Python 3 text processing with nltk 3 cookbook kindle edition by perkins, jacob. The book is based on the python programming language together with an open source library called the natural language toolkit nltk. The natural language toolkit nltk python basics nltk texts lists distributions control structures nested blocks new data pos tagging basic tagging tagged corpora automatic tagging python nltk is based on python i we will assume python 2. Natural language processing using python with nltk, scikitlearn and stanford nlp apis viva institute of technology, 2016. Since nltk is a suite of python libraries, python knowledge is a prerequisite. The nltk book teaches nltk and python simultaneously. It works with your favorite parser to provide idiomatic ways of.
1327 991 588 424 1326 229 964 738 830 927 305 759 1451 679 317 526 124 657 344 423 713 491 236 1325 921 177 988 680 599 596 1316 207